01- Management of Infarction During the COVID-19 Pandemic Patients with cardiovascular disease infected with COVID-19 are at a particular risk for morbidity and mortality. In any case, it should be noted that most patients requiring cardiovascular care due to ischemic heart disease, peripheral vascular disease, or structural heart disease are not infected. Official Announcement: Honduras Regional Sessions 2020 Postponed
Due to the global health crisis caused by the COVID-19 (coronavirus), the Latin American Society of Interventional Cardiology calls off Honduras Regional Sessions 2020, set for June 4 and 5 in the city of San Pedro Tula, until further notice. This decision is guided by the prevention criteria and extreme care measures meant to protect…
